The global power quality equipment market is witnessing significant growth driven by various factors such as the increasing adoption of renewable energy sources, the rise in industrial automation, and the growing sensitivity of electronic devices to power disturbances. Power conditioning equipment is crucial for maintaining the quality of power supply by regulating voltage levels and reducing surges or sags that can damage equipment. Harmonic filters are essential in mitigating harmonics that can cause voltage fluctuations and distortions in electrical systems. Surge protection devices play a vital role in safeguarding equipment from sudden spikes in voltage due to lightning strikes or switching operations. Uninterruptible Power Supply (UPS) systems are critical for providing backup power during outages to ensure uninterrupted operation for sensitive equipment.

Centralized power quality systems involve a centralized point of control for managing power quality across a facility or network. These systems offer centralized monitoring and control, making them ideal for large-scale applications where centralized management is essential. On the other hand, distributed power quality systems consist of decentralized units that provide localized power quality control. Distributed systems are more flexible and scalable, allowing for targeted power quality solutions in specific areas of a facility or network.

In terms of end-users, the industrial and manufacturing sector is a significant consumer of power quality equipment due to the heavy reliance on machinery and automation technologies. Ensuring consistent and clean power supply is crucial for maintaining the efficiency and reliability of industrial operations. Commercial establishments, such as office buildings, data centers, and retail spaces, also require power quality equipment to protect sensitive electronics and ensure smooth business operations. Residential buildings are increasingly adopting power quality solutions to protect household appliances, electronic devices, and to ensure the safety and comfort of residents.

With increasing awareness about the importance of power quality in various industries and sectors, the market is expected to witness continued growth and innovation in the coming years.The global power quality equipment market is poised for significant growth due to several key drivers impacting the industry. One of the primary factors propelling market expansion is the increasing adoption of renewable energy sources worldwide. As more countries and industries transition towards cleaner energy alternatives, the need for effective power quality equipment becomes critical to ensure the stability and reliability of power supply. The integration of renewable energy sources such as solar and wind power can introduce fluctuations in the grid that necessitate the use of power conditioning equipment, harmonic filters, and surge protection devices to maintain consistent power quality.

Another major driver fueling market growth is the rise in industrial automation across various sectors. Industries are increasingly leveraging automation technologies to enhance productivity, efficiency, and operational performance. The heavy reliance on machinery and automated systems in industrial and manufacturing facilities underscores the importance of deploying robust power quality solutions to prevent downtime, equipment damage, and production disruptions. Power conditioning equipment and uninterruptible power supply (UPS) systems play a crucial role in ensuring continuous and clean power supply to support seamless industrial operations.

Moreover, the growing sensitivity of electronic devices to power disturbances is driving the demand for advanced power quality equipment. With the proliferation of sophisticated electronics in both commercial and residential settings, protecting sensitive equipment from voltage fluctuations, harmonics, and electrical surges is paramount. Surge protection devices and harmonic filters are essential components in safeguarding electronic devices from potential damage caused by power irregularities, thereby increasing the adoption of power quality solutions across various end-user segments.
